  • Abstract
    The performance of large, highly thinned array antenna configurations are investigated in view of surface imaging radar applications. The suitability of a spatial tapering method, of a fractal structure and of a combinatorial algorithm for processing (focussing) radar data is evaluated. To this end, fully vectorial information, obtained from histatic, synthetic aperture measurements performed with a stepped frequency radar, is employed. The images generated with sparse configurations show attractive features even for large thinning rates of up to 75%.
